    After joining this forum about 2 weeks ago not knowing what laptop I want and posting thread after thread looking and learning about what I want, I found the one. And bought it!

    I am the new owner (as soon as it comes in) of the Asus F8SN-B1.

    Processor Intel T8100 2.1ghz 3mb cache 800FSB Penryn
    Memory 3gb (1gb+2gb) DDR2 667mhz
    Hard Drive 250gb 5400rpm SATA 8mb Cache
    Video Graphics NVIDIA® GeForce® 9500M GS512MB
    Display 14" WXGA (1280x800) Glare
    Optical Drive 8x Super-Multi DVDRW Dual layer
    Operating System windows vista home premium
    Other Options: Asus messenger bag included, Internal Bluetooth 2.0 included, Asus mouse included
    Camera 1.3M Megabyte Pixels swivel
    Chipset Mobile Intel® 965 PM Express Chipset + ICH8M
    Card Reader 5-in-1 (MMC, SD, MS/MS-Pro, XD)

    This laptop was everything I was looking for and a lot more.

    Well good deal. I bought the same notebook almost a month ago. Its been on 24/7 & I haven't hardly touched my desktop since ! I did buy a Zalmon cooler because I was a little concerned with heat with it being on all the time but it turns out I did not need it although I still use it. I have a USB keyboard & a external LCD hooked to it. I also added 4gb of G.Skill & it made a definite improvement in speed. That & removing some bloat is all I've done. I bought mine via ExcaliberPC & I could not be more happy.
